Things to know.
The Class system is sorta like Blue Dragon meets Devil may cry
Basically you level up skills in battle independent of your actual stats. most skills require a specific weapon but in general that's a pretty lax restriction overall. Your class does restrict your weapon choices though so it's basically a trying a little bit of everything( at least two advanced classes let you use magic items and normal weapons) to see what you like. You can only use six skills at any given time and you need to switch them at an inn.
Pawns are useful.
It's shocking I know but Capcom made a good AI buddy.
Pawns if designed well compliment your character, they can tank for a mage or cast spells to support you.
You can buy more Pawns which is the games primary online component. Other players Pawns can know things yours don't including how to complete entire quest lines or weak spots for monsters . Your pawn does not level up while out but it does remember encounters and quests and it can bring back loot.
The combat is awesome.
Long story short you're a slower Dante in most classes. Except you can divebomb a flaming griffon into a cliff
The world is designed to kill you.
A nice walk through the woods can be interrupted by anything from goblins to boss level threats. Going out at night is not recommended and should always have a lantern on hand because things do in fact creep in the shadows and they have knives.
Equipment is rare and/or expensive
You have to think about each purchase because money and loot are hard won. There is a crafting system but it requires you kill things and early on that's not as easy as it seems.
You can forge items and revive NPCs you've killed.
Yeah this is fucking awesome. Basically you can give a guy a booc of seplls instead of the book of spells he wanted. It may piss him off later though. In the same way you can use your revival items on NPCs thus allowing you to finish their quest lines if you have to murder them for someone else.
